Okay so heres the deal lately since ive installed Mountain Lion and the new Traktor Pro 2.5.1 along with the New Beta drivers. I've been getting a loss in timecode signal on both decks so it skips it also does this after an hour of playtime which is weird its everytime too so then i have to turn the s4 off then turn back on and were good and working again this never happened before i have a radio show twice a week i really would like to see if anyone is having the same problem i believe its the beta drivers myself.

Traktor S4

Traktor Kontrol F1

2 CDJ 800 MK2

Macbook Pro mid 2009 2.53ghz 8gb ram

blue icicle usb mic


Firewire 800 external drive 320gb
---
Mabey its my latency i had it set to 8.7 ms final ill try with 10.2 ms.I do have nicecast running for my radio show along with my mic and my f1 with a usb hub and my firewire HD could latency be the issue ?
